The keyword refers to the specific Nintendo Switch title ID for Mystery no Arukikata (localized as Path of Mystery: A Brush with Death ). Published by Imagineer and developed by Toybox Inc., this visual novel adventure was released on December 12, 2024, as the first installment in a planned trilogy. The game is primarily available on the Nintendo Switch and Steam. For collectors, physical editions can be found through retailers like AmiAmi and CDJapan.
One of the most praised aspects of the game is its visual contrast between time periods.
Reviewers from sites like Digitally Downloaded and GameFAQs note that while it may not have the massive budget of franchises like Ace Attorney or Danganronpa , it offers a compelling, character-driven mystery with gorgeous art.
